Seperated Kitchen Cabinet

Recommended Posts

Dear Mr Chong

Please take a look at my floor plan. if you notice, my kitchen layout is abit odd. My water pipe and drainage is on 1 side and my gas pipe is on another side.

my uncle has said that is a taboo to have a cabinet on 1 side with the hob and hood, another 1 for the washing basin. according to him, it mean husband and wife will divorce. Worst is that such design will have opposing fire and water element.

Are u able to share with me what i can do??

You don't want the sink to be directly opposit the stove i.e. fire clashing with water.

You also don't want the sink to be next to the stove. They should be at least one to two feet apart.

Hello

If you're talking about gas pipes and drainage, concealment should do the job. On the other hand, with the gas stove and the wash basin facing each other won't be appropriate. You probably have to realign (It actually depends on your FS environment). There are much discussions on this topic previously. Some of your questions can be found in those posts.

Not to worry too much about this. If it bothers you, just reno it. Looking at your design, should be an apt block and that goes the same for every floor and other blocks. One cannot simply just jump to such conclusion quickly without consideration into other conditional factors, otherwise your whole neighborhood will bring the divorce rate up in Singapore. :)
